If I am ingame standing in one spot to create a new npc, I simply do this :

#spawn (name_whatever) (shows up as human, intially)
#npcspawn create (with npc targetted)
#repop

Then do any #npcedit 's needed. (race, whatever) But to each their own.
I actually have hotkeys for the npcspawn create and repop.
